Default Re: Flopped bottom 2 pr. with \"Huh??\" action

Yeah, you might have the best hand now (I'm not too afraid of a set either although TT is possible), but there are a TON of cards that will probably give you the worst hand. Let's count em:

3 T's
3 3's
3 6's
3 7's
3 8's
9 clubs

Not to mention any card that gives an overpair trips. That's 24 cards we DON'T want to see to the 4 cards that fill me up. If we happen to be up against that set of tens we are REALLY screwed. Just to put light on how easy a fold this is w/ the action.
